Why should you take this course?

Understanding Advanced Mathematical Concepts: Logarithms are fundamental to many areas of mathematics, including algebra, calculus, and number theory. A Level 3 course delves deeper into logarithmic functions and their properties, providing a more thorough understanding of these concepts.

Preparation for Further Studies: If you plan to pursue higher education or a career in fields such as mathematics, engineering, physics, or computer science, a solid understanding of logarithms is essential. Many advanced topics in these fields build upon logarithmic functions.

Problem-Solving Skills: Logarithms are often used to solve complex mathematical problems, both in theoretical and practical contexts. Learning how to manipulate logarithmic equations and apply logarithmic properties can enhance your problem-solving skills.

Real-World Applications: Logarithmic functions are widely used in various real-world scenarios, such as in finance, biology, chemistry, and physics. Understanding logarithms can help you interpret and analyse data in these fields more effectively.

Enhanced Mathematical Fluency: Mastery of logarithmic functions contributes to overall mathematical fluency and confidence. It enables you to approach a wider range of mathematical problems with ease and flexibility.

Career Opportunities: Some careers require a strong foundation in mathematics, including logarithms. Whether you're interested in becoming an engineer, scientist, economist, or data analyst, proficiency in logarithmic functions can open doors to diverse career opportunities.

Intellectual Development: Studying logarithms at a higher level fosters critical thinking, logical reasoning, and abstract problem-solving skills. These intellectual abilities are valuable not only in mathematics but also in many other areas of life and work.

Overall, taking a Level 3 course on logarithms can provide you with valuable knowledge and skills that are applicable across various academic disciplines and professional fields. It lays a solid foundation for further learning and intellectual growth.
